Why rent an apartment with utilities included in Chillum, MD?
The best thing about living in a utilities-included apartment is that, as a renter, you don't have to deal with utility providers. That responsibility is transferred to your property management/landlord in exchange for a monthly flat fee added to your rent.
What are the downsides of renting an apartment with utilities included in Chillum, MD?
Utilities-included apartments are usually found in older apartment communities, which some renters might consider unsuitable for their lifestyle.
